Abstract

Prince Gebang was one of the local rulers who collaborated with the VOC at the end of the 17th century. His domain, named as the Principality of Gebang (Kepangeranan Gebang), extended from the northern coastal area of Gebang Sea to the south side of the Cijolang River bordering on Galuh. Although the name of Sutajaya is clearly written as Prince Gebang (Pangeran Gebang) in the colonial archives, his identity and his travel process towards the power of the Gebang area was not clearly explained at all. This paper seeks to reveal the image of Prince Gebang through Babad Sutajaya manuscript stored in Pangeran (Prince) Pasarean Museum. From the ancient manuscripts, taken a number of essences related footage Sutajaya figure to study. The historical elements contained in the affinity of the story, comparated with records of colonial archives and sources of oral traditions that exist. From this research it is known that Babad Sutajaya depicts the image of Prince Gebang as an important figure, who came from the royal court of Cirebon. In addition, this manuscript also illustrates Prince Gebang's abilities and reveals how he gained the territory of Gebang as his controlled area

Abstract

Writing skills are definitely essential to be mastered by students. This study described the efforts of Arabic education department of Indonesia University of Education (IUOE) in improving students’ writing skill, specifically in writing journal articles. Descriptive qualitative method was used in this study. This study involved 25 postgraduate students. Data collection was carried out through questionnaires, interviews, and documentation. The results of this study showed there are four stages that can be performed to improve students’ writing skill in writing journal article, namely 1) Identifying students’ various difficulties in writing scientific journal articles, 2) conducting trainings of scientific journal articles through zoom meeting application in which the materials are based on the problems faced by the postgraduate students, 3) evaluating scientific journal articles that have been written by the postgraduate students, and 4) knowing the students’ perceptions regarding scientific journal article training activities through distributing the questionnaires.

Abstract

The internet continues to interact with almost every aspect of life, teachers will have more choices to utilize the Internet into the learning process. This study aims to determine the use of the internet by teachers in vocational high schools based on their age. The results of the study were obtained from interviews with teachers. Data from interviews were processed using qualitative methods. The results of the study describe that teachers use the internet to support their learning process. The findings obtained in this study are that older teachers have conducted software development training, while younger teachers have not yet attended training, attracting younger teachers to be more skilled in internet use than older teachers.

Abstract

Providing student well-being in the midst of the covid-19 pandemic is very important to achieve the objectives of teaching and learning Arabic. Lecturers as one component of education are required to have competence in managing teaching and learning processes and pleasant teaching and learning interactions with the students. Therefore, this study aimed to explore the processes of teaching and learning Arabic in private Islamic universities based on the synchronous and asynchronous basis in building student well-being. This study used a descriptive qualitative approach with three data collection techniques, namely observation, interviews, and documentation. The results of the study showed that synchronous and asynchronous-based teaching and learning in the midst of the covid-19 pandemic was able to build student well-being. It was confirmed by the number of 25 students who took part in the Arabic teaching and learning processes, 80% of students were very happy and excited about the approach and method used by the lecturer in teaching and learning Arabic. In addition, students and lecturers produce learning products, namely the Indonesian-Arabic Economics dictionary book. The results of the study are expected to be an alternative consideration for Arabic language lecturers at the university level in dealing with online lectures in the midst of the covid19 pandemic.

Abstract

Changes in values often occurred in education are changes in the characters of generation of the nation, Indonesian students, who are far from the values of courtesy. Therefore, preventive and curative efforts are necessary to solve those problems, involving serving the community. Thus, this study was aimed at revealing the efforts to build the Qur’anic generation through internalizing politeness values in language use in light of the Qur’an perspective. Politeness principles in language use in the Qur’an were reflected in six phrases, namely; qaulan sadidan, ma’rufan, balighan, maysuran, layyinan, and kariman. The target of the activities in this study was Islamic forums, youth organizations, teachers, and parents. The results of this study indicated that the internalization of politeness values in language use in light of the Qur’an perspective was well and perfectly aligned, while the politeness values in language use in the perspective of the Qur'an practiced by the participants in their daily life were justice, honesty, gentleness, assertiveness, generosity, calmness, kindness, smooth, pleasant, polite and modesty.

Abstract

This research aims to improve learning quality by implementing a scientific approach with quantum teaching settings in elementary school. The research method used is classroom action research, which has two cycles. Data collection instruments include observation sheets for implementing scientific approaches with quantum teaching settings and test items for learning outcomes. The results of the study show that in cycle I, both the teacher's skills and student activities indicate that students enjoy the learning activities, as evidenced by the emoticon choices of the 24 attending students; eight students chose the "very happy" emoticon, eleven students chose the "happy" emoticon, and five students chose the "neutral" emoticon. Meanwhile, in cycle II, out of the 24 attending students, 14 students chose the "very happy" emoticon, 11 students chose the "happy" emoticon, and one student chose the "neutral" emoticon. Regarding student learning outcomes, the average score in cycle I was 52.50%, which increased to 69.25% in cycle II. These results indicate that implementing scientific approaches with quantum teaching settings can improve the quality of education in schools.

Abstract

Spices and Ports are two things that cannot be separated in the commercial transformation that occurred centuries ago. The two are related to each other and form a knot that is interdependent and gives rise to various reactions and ambitions that occur among every noble and ruler who wants to control commerce. This is also related to various trading ports in Indonesia such as Sriwijaya, Pasai, and Malacca. The fall of Malacca into the hands of the Portuguese resulted in a shift in trade routes directed to the Red Sea, this was seriously used by the Sultanate of Aceh Darussalam to seize international scale trade. So this research aims to present a reconstruction of maritime trade routes that occurred in the territory of the Sultanate of Aceh Darussalam so that it discusses trade routes, commodities and even payment instruments used in each of these periods and how the policies of each sultan/ah in the Aceh Darussalam Sultanate towards trade routes maritime events that occurred in the 17th century AD. The research method used is the historical research method which consists of 4 stages, namely heuristics, criticism, interpretation, and historiography. This research resulted in the trading routes of the Sultanate of Aceh Darussalam, trade commodities such as pepper, oil, tin, policies and regulations that apply in regulating trade mobility including means of payment in the form of deureuham, ketun, and Spanish ringgit as well as the role of the sultan/ah in establishing trade policies to obtain a lot of advantages such as rising pepper prices (Iskandar Muda era), diplomacy with England (during Al-Mukamil), tin monopoly on silver (during Sultanah Safiatuddin's time).Keywords: Commerce, Maritime, Sultan/ah, Aceh Darussalam

Abstract

Teachers' didactic multilingual competence in Arabic teaching can also help students develop their speaking skills. They can get used to correct pronunciation and intonation through this multilingual approach, which can be applied in everyday communication. This study aimed to explore teachers' didactic multilingual competence in teaching Arabic in the classroom. The approach in this study uses a mixed method. The design used in this research is the exploratory sequential design. The number of participants in the study was 30 Arabic teachers who taught at Madrasah Aliyah in the Greater Bandung area. The results of this study indicate that out of 30 Arabic teachers, (1) the teacher always identifies students' difficulties in speaking Arabic and other foreign languages by 50%, (2) The teacher never opens and presents learning material using Arabic and other foreign languages is still in the category low as much as 50%, (3) the teacher never explains the differences and similarities of Arabic with other foreign languages in conveying material (contrastive) as much as 37%, and (4) the teacher always corrects students' grammatical and phonological errors in expressing Arabic or foreign language sentences as much as 60%. The results of this study are expected to be a reference for stakeholders in the school environment in improving the didactic multilingual competence of Arabic teachers.
